{"id":4880,"date":"2012-01-01T12:00:23","date_gmt":"2012-01-01T20:00:23","guid":{"rendered":"http:\/\/www.holywell.ca\/rent\/?p=4880"},"modified":"2012-10-26T11:41:12","modified_gmt":"2012-10-26T18:41:12","slug":"canucks-flag-part-i-2","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.holywell.ca\/rent\/canucks-flag-part-i-2\/","title":{"rendered":"Canucks Flag Part I"},"content":{"rendered":"<p>It seems an owner (Let\u2019s call him Jack) and a council member (Jill) had ongoing differences of opinion about the Canucks flag draped over his balcony during hockey season.<\/p>\n<p>Jack put his condo on the market and got a great offer \u2013 but when Jack went asking for an Information Certificate (Form B) from the strata council, Jill (being a Flames fan) refused to provide the form unless Jack removed the flag.<\/p>\n<p>Was she, as a council member, in the right? No! Section 59(1) of the Act states \u201cWithin one week of a request by an owner, a purchaser or a person authorized by an owner or purchaser, the strata corporation must give to the person making the request an Information Certificate in the prescribed form.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Now let\u2019s say the sale fell through because Jack could not give the Form B to the buyer and he didn\u2019t get another offer for 2 months and it was $10,000 less. The strata corporation is served with a writ by Jack\u2019s lawyer, and Jill is put into the position of explaining to the ownership about why they need to pay a special levy for legal fees.<\/p>\n<p>Having worked with over a hundred strata councils, I find it is not uncommon for personal feelings or opinions to get involved in the decisions sometimes made by councils.<\/p>\n<p>However, following the letter of the law is the best (and cheapest!) way to go.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>More on that Canucks fl ag and bylaws next month&#8230; go, Canucks, go!<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>[author] [author_image timthumb=&#8217;on&#8217;]http:\/\/www.holywell.ca\/rent\/wp-content\/uploads\/2012\/07\/Niina-Mayhew.jpg[\/author_image] [author_info]<\/p>\n<p>Niina Mayhew, the strata manager for Holywell Properties, has close to twenty five years of experience in the real estate industry.<\/p>\n<p>She recently moved to the Sunshine Coast from the Thompson Okanagan region to be closer to family.
